A CAMPAIGN calling upon the government to provide more affordable housing, protect vulnerable people and end the housing divide has been embraced across Cumbria.
At the Shelter office in Kendal, staff and clients from the UK’s leading housing and homelessness charity donned campaign t-shirts and waved placards stating “Now is the Time” to tackle the housing crisis.
The Now is the Time Campaign is a direct response to a recent YouGov survey, which revealed that almost 250,000 households across the northwest are constantly struggling or falling behind with their rent or mortgage payments, with many sacrificing food and borrowing from friends in order to keep a roof over their heads.
